Fire Service Department Bringing In Volunteers

Planning to develop an auxiliary force comprising of men of all areas is the Fire Service Department, adding onto the existing team. The volunteers will help out during fire accidents and to be of support during rescuing missions for emergencies and calamities.

As of now, a total of 110 volunteers have enrolled themselves during a meeting that was organised on Tuesday. It is the fire department’s target to form at least 2000 volunteers, said Fire Service officer J Mohan Rao.

There will be a meeting held for the security agencies soon in which 11 agencies are likely to attend and have promised to send 10 men each. In future they are intending to call NCC and NSS cadets to volunteer said the Assistant District Fire Officer Surendra Anand.

These volunteer will go through a seven-day training program in firefighting, rescue operations and first aid. The Andhra Pradesh State Disaster Response and Fire Services previously held a meeting to address the issue of severe shortage of personnel and came up with this solution.
